html{
    background:url('/theme/progressbar.gif');
    background-repeat: no-repeat;
    background-position: 46vw 49vh;
}

body, #userinfo, #banner, body > br, .topright-menu{
    display:none;
}

#loginform{
    position: relative;
    padding-top: 48px;
    padding-left: 29px;
    text-align: left;
    color: black;
    position:relative;		
    font-family:"Arial";
    font-size:0;   
    width: 1069px;
    border: 1px solid black;
    margin-bottom: 10px;
    z-index: 2;
}

#loginform[action*="admin"]{
    height: 205px;
}

#loginform:after{
    content: "Sign In";
    position: absolute;
    top: -1px;
    left: 0;
    padding-left: 59px;
    padding-top: 10px;
    width: 1040px;
    height: 24px;
    background-color: #414141;
    background-repeat:no-repeat;
    background-position: 75px 27px, 0px 0px;  
    background-size: 13px 6.5px, 1100px 40px;
    background-image: url('/theme/selector-light.png');
    background-image: url('/theme/selector-light.png'),linear-gradient(to bottom, #414141 0%,#363636 31%,#343434 32%,#2f2f2f 42%,#242424 68%,#1f1f1f 74%,#1f1f1f 78%,#191919 91%,#1a1a1a 95%,#181818 96%,#171717 100%);
    font-size: 14px;
    font-weight: 700;
    color: white;
    z-index: -1;
}

#loginform br{
    font-size: 10px;
}

#loginfield{
    background-color: rgb(250, 255, 189);
    padding: 1px;
    font: 13.3333px Arial;
    width: 220px;
    height: 30px;
    box-sizing: border-box;
    border: 1px solid #c6c6c6;
    margin-bottom: 3px;
    padding-left: 10px;
}

#passwordfield{
    background-color: rgb(250, 255, 189);
    padding: 1px;
    font: 13.3333px Arial;
    width: 220px;
    height: 30px;
    box-sizing: border-box;
    border: 1px solid #c6c6c6;
    padding-left: 10px;
}

#loginform[action*="admin"] #passwordfield {
    position: absolute;
    top: 59px;
}

#loginbutton{
    border: 1px solid #3062a1;
    background-color: #518cc9;
    background: linear-gradient(to bottom, #b1cce5 0%,#518cc9 8%,#3062a1 100%);
    font-size: 16px;
    font-family: 'Open Sans',arial,sans-serif;
    color: #fff;
    text-transform: capitalize;
    height: 37px;
    width: 164px;
    margin-bottom: 50px;
	margin-top: 20px;
}

#loginbutton:hover{
    background: linear-gradient(to bottom, #a2bbcc 0%,#4a7faf 8%,#2c5989 100%); 
}

#loginform[action*="admin"] #loginbutton{
    position: absolute;
    top: 122px;
    left: 29px;
}

#registerLink{
    position: absolute;
    left: 184px;
    z-index: 10;
    font-size: 14px;
    font-weight: 700;
    color: #D1D1D1;
    text-decoration: none;
    top: 163px;
}

#registerLink:hover{
    color: white;
}